I am running a campaign in 5E ruleset and hit an issue with LoS last night while we were playing.

The players had gone through a portion of the map already and decided they need to go back to a safer room and do a rest. Since there was not going to be anything along the path for them and to speed it up, I used the function on the Combat Tracker of grabbing the Green helmet to move all of the players to the room at once.

When I did this; all of the players lose their remembered map LoS for where they had already gone through. I understand that the remembered LoS gets lost if you put the tokens on another map; but it seems like the same happens if you use the Combat Tracker helmets to move groups as one.

Is this a known issue? Or expected behavior?

Yes, this is expected. By using the green skull icon you are effectively removing the tokens and replacing them on the map - and thus the tokens lose the fog of war.

As GM you can select and drag all the tokens. Holding shift (or alt?) While you do this allows you to drag through walls and not reveal Los during movement.

It is Shift. I move some tokens that way already. and it only does not reveal LoS if you do not stop along the path to get where you are going.
